Neighborhood dog park planned for East Main Street

A virtual, public input session on plans for a new park in southeast Ashland will be hosted by the Parks & Recreation Commission from 6 to 8 p.m. Thursday, March 3. APRC and consultants will talk about a conceptual park design and the various elements involved, in addition to a tentative project timeline.

KS Wild Side: Making roads safer for people and wildlife

America’s road network, as currently designed, is a major impediment to migration. Fragmentation of habitat caused by roads prevents animals from accessing food and water. For animals both large and small, roads also reduce a species’ long-term viability.
